Basic anatomy of the forearm bones
The forearm contains two long bones: the radius and the ulna. They run parallel between the elbow and the wrist and participate in hinge, pivot, and gliding motions. The ulna contributes most to the hinge at the elbow through its large trochlear notch, while the radius is key to rotation at both the proximal and distal radioulnar joints. Their relative positions shift with supination and pronation, but specific landmarks consistently indicate which side is which.

How forearm rotation changes positions
Supination and pronation rotate the radius around the ulna at the proximal and distal joints. Key points of rotation
- Proximal radioulnar joint: the head of the radius rotates in the radial notch of the ulna.
- Distal radioulnar joint: the ulnar notch of the radius receives the head of the ulna.
- These joints enable pronation and supination while maintaining overall forearm length and stability.

Why this distinction matters
Identifying the radius as the thumb-side bone is important for interpreting fractures, planning surgical approaches, and understanding movement patterns. Injuries to the radius near the thumb side, such as distal radius fractures, commonly affect wrist function. Correct labeling also supports clear communication among clinicians, patients, and imaging professionals.
